Contradicting Travel Advisories: Analyzing the Risks and Safety of Royal Caribbean Destinations

The recent contrasting travel advisories issued by the U.S. government for Royal Caribbean’s destinations have raised significant concerns among travelers. While some locations are deemed safe with minimal risk, others are flagged as high-risk areas, leading to confusion for vacationers eager to enjoy a getaway. A breakdown of the differing advisories illustrates a complex landscape of safety that can influence traveler decisions immensely:

  • Safe Destinations: The U.S. government has rated certain Caribbean islands, like Cozumel, Mexico, and Nassau, Bahamas, as lower-risk areas, emphasizing their robust tourism infrastructure and low crime rates.
  • High-Risk Areas: Conversely, destinations such as Labadee, Haiti, have been categorized as hazardous due to increasing violence and civil unrest, prompting advisory levels that may deter travelers.

Understanding these discrepancies is essential for planning a secure and enjoyable trip. Travelers are encouraged to consider various factors, including local conditions, safety measures implemented by Royal Caribbean, and personal comfort levels with each destination’s risk profile. The following table summarizes the current advisory ratings for selected Royal Caribbean ports:

DestinationAdvisory LevelNotes
Cozumel, MexicoLevel 2: Exercise Increased CautionTourist-friendly areas; low crime rate
Nassau, BahamasLevel 2: Exercise Increased CautionBusy tourist destination; local guidance available
Labadee, HaitiLevel 4: Do Not TravelPolitical unrest; safety concerns reported

Expert Insights and Recommendations for Navigating Travel Advisories While Cruising

As travelers set sail with Royal Caribbean, understanding the nuances of current travel advisories is critical. The U.S. government sometimes issues conflicting guidance, which can cause confusion. Experts recommend that cruisers stay informed by regularly checking official government websites and the cruise line’s updates. Specifically, consider the following strategies:

  • Stay Updated: Sign up for notifications from the State Department and Royal Caribbean regarding your itinerary.
  • Consult Travel Insurance: Ensure your insurance covers cancellations related to travel advisories.
  • Engage with Cruise Communities: Join online forums and groups to share insights and experiences with other travelers.

When evaluating travel advisories, it’s also advisable to analyze the risks in each destination. Here’s a snapshot of how to interpret the advisory levels:

Advisory LevelDescriptionRecommendations
Level 1Exercise Normal PrecautionsTravel as planned; remain vigilant.
Level 2Exercise Increased CautionReview local conditions; consider personal safety.
Level 3Reconsider TravelAssess reasons for travel; weigh risks carefully.
Level 4Do Not TravelAvoid the destination; seek alternative plans.
